aboutsummaryrefslogtreecommitdiff
path: root/analysis/current/sections/cost-model-primrose_library--EagerSortedVec
diff options
context:
space:
mode:
Diffstat (limited to 'analysis/current/sections/cost-model-primrose_library--EagerSortedVec')
-rw-r--r--analysis/current/sections/cost-model-primrose_library--EagerSortedVec50
1 files changed, 50 insertions, 0 deletions
diff --git a/analysis/current/sections/cost-model-primrose_library--EagerSortedVec b/analysis/current/sections/cost-model-primrose_library--EagerSortedVec
new file mode 100644
index 0000000..ef8f861
--- /dev/null
+++ b/analysis/current/sections/cost-model-primrose_library--EagerSortedVec
@@ -0,0 +1,50 @@
+:1709829825:cost-model-primrose_library--EagerSortedVec
+cost-model-primrose_library--EagerSortedVec
+/run/current-system/sw/bin/candelabra-cli -l cost-model primrose_library::EagerSortedVec
+[2024-03-07T16:43:45Z INFO candelabra_cli] Using source dir: "/nix/store/62sivksb29gn76l89v3hwvni26baphq5-source"
+[2024-03-07T16:43:45Z DEBUG candelabra::candidates] Initialised candidate cacher with hash 10402570600929242768
+[2024-03-07T16:43:45Z DEBUG primrose::library_specs] Failed to process library module /nix/store/62sivksb29gn76l89v3hwvni26baphq5-source/crates/library/src/adaptive.rs. Continuing anyway.
+[2024-03-07T16:43:45Z DEBUG primrose::library_specs] Failed to process library module /nix/store/62sivksb29gn76l89v3hwvni26baphq5-source/crates/library/src/profiler.rs. Continuing anyway.
+[2024-03-07T16:43:45Z DEBUG primrose::library_specs] Failed to process library module /nix/store/62sivksb29gn76l89v3hwvni26baphq5-source/crates/library/src/traits.rs. Continuing anyway.
+[2024-03-07T16:43:45Z DEBUG candelabra::cost] Initialised benchmark cacher with hash 10402570600929242768
+[2024-03-07T16:43:46Z INFO candelabra_cli::model] Calculating cost model for primrose_library::EagerSortedVec
+[2024-03-07T16:43:46Z INFO candelabra::cost::benchmark] Preparing benchmarking crate for primrose_library::EagerSortedVec in "/tmp/.tmppiGs0d"
+[2024-03-07T16:43:46Z INFO candelabra::cost::benchmark] Building and running benchmarks for primrose_library::EagerSortedVec
+ Updating crates.io index
+ Compiling bench v0.1.0 (/tmp/.tmppiGs0d)
+ Finished release [optimized] target(s) in 1.06s
+ Running `/opt/candelabra/src/target/release/bench --bench`
+[2024-03-07T16:47:32Z DEBUG candelabra::cost] Fitting op insert with 400 observations
+[2024-03-07T16:47:32Z DEBUG candelabra::cost] Fitting op first with 400 observations
+[2024-03-07T16:47:32Z DEBUG candelabra::cost] Fitting op contains with 400 observations
+[2024-03-07T16:47:32Z DEBUG candelabra::cost] Fitting op nth with 400 observations
+[2024-03-07T16:47:32Z DEBUG candelabra::cost] Fitting op remove with 400 observations
+[2024-03-07T16:47:32Z DEBUG candelabra::cost] Fitting op clear with 400 observations
+[2024-03-07T16:47:32Z DEBUG candelabra::cost] Fitting op last with 400 observations
+┌──────────┬─────────────────────┬────────────────────────┬──────────────────────────────┬─────────────────────┬─────────────────────┐
+│ │ coeff 0 │ coeff 1 │ coeff 2 │ coeff 3 │ nrmse │
+├──────────┼─────────────────────┼────────────────────────┼──────────────────────────────┼─────────────────────┼─────────────────────┤
+│ clear │ 8.360099942840861 │ 0.0007511407131532699 │ -0.0000000015604150691930547 │ 3.1745594185716755 │ 0.39881673114653066 │
+│ nth │ -4.153716586512019 │ 0.0002480119497290101 │ 0.000000009200662161764998 │ 4.364748359905775 │ 0.5542592545704063 │
+│ last │ -8.811356284894828 │ -0.0010648746444896218 │ 0.000000030241860731407824 │ 5.7033513083757725 │ 0.47661021200864584 │
+│ contains │ 171.675095941373 │ 0.017527091727466693 │ -0.00000019636492211331772 │ -15.618069505718495 │ 4.254169073057398 │
+│ remove │ 436.71055399870966 │ 0.1150752395338337 │ 0.0000009306355233769587 │ -50.870169701876875 │ 0.916059449754812 │
+│ insert │ 304.789653642918 │ 0.06530356732243714 │ 0.00000024265152630430415 │ -37.473979466074525 │ 0.11546500678751422 │
+│ first │ -15.778908014964145 │ -0.0026233158889280017 │ 0.00000006498653330821493 │ 7.078049912935171 │ 1.2871110457094541 │
+└──────────┴─────────────────────┴────────────────────────┴──────────────────────────────┴─────────────────────┴─────────────────────┘
+\begin{center}
+\begin{tabular}{|c|c|c|c|c|c|}
+ & coeff 0 & coeff 1 & coeff 2 & coeff 3 & nrmse \\
+\hline
+clear & 8.360099942840861 & 0.0007511407131532699 & -0.0000000015604150691930547 & 3.1745594185716755 & 0.39881673114653066 \\
+nth & -4.153716586512019 & 0.0002480119497290101 & 0.000000009200662161764998 & 4.364748359905775 & 0.5542592545704063 \\
+last & -8.811356284894828 & -0.0010648746444896218 & 0.000000030241860731407824 & 5.7033513083757725 & 0.47661021200864584 \\
+contains & 171.675095941373 & 0.017527091727466693 & -0.00000019636492211331772 & -15.618069505718495 & 4.254169073057398 \\
+remove & 436.71055399870966 & 0.1150752395338337 & 0.0000009306355233769587 & -50.870169701876875 & 0.916059449754812 \\
+insert & 304.789653642918 & 0.06530356732243714 & 0.00000024265152630430415 & -37.473979466074525 & 0.11546500678751422 \\
+first & -15.778908014964145 & -0.0026233158889280017 & 0.00000006498653330821493 & 7.078049912935171 & 1.2871110457094541 \\
+\end{tabular}
+\end{center}
+section_end:1709830052:cost-model-primrose_library--EagerSortedVec
+
+ \ No newline at end of file